I have mixed opinions about Observation, a game in the 'Something Goes Wrong in Space' genre. While I enjoyed the beginning and the role of being the station's AI, the frequent lack of a map and controls (especially mouse acceleration) made navigation and certain tasks difficult, and I would have preferred if the story stayed as realistic as the space disaster at the beginning felt.

Spoilers! I loved the game at first, but the ending refused to explain anything, in that frustrating way modern horror does these days. All of the standard tropes of People Behaving Out of Character, Blood on the Walls, and Infinite Duplicates show up, and the Spooky Hexagon of Saturn refuses to give us any coherent answers, instead forcing us to play Simon Says for its amusement. How did we get from Earth to Saturn in no time at all? Why is everyone on the second space station (including another SAM) apparently evil (but sans goatee)? Why isn't Emma even remotely surprised to find earthlike terrain on Saturn's pole? The answer apparently lies in way too many minigames.
